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/230.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 安卓-手指触摸式监听器_Android_Touch_Listener - Fatal编程技术网

Android 安卓-手指触摸式监听器

Android 安卓-手指触摸式监听器,android,touch,listener,Android,Touch,Listener,我只有这个代码,但这不是个好主意 在安卓系统中,如何使用手指制作左键点击监听器 @Override public boolean onTouchEvent(MotionEvent event) { // TODO Auto-generated method stub super.onTouchEvent(event); int action = event.getAction() & MotionEvent.ACTION_MASK; float x1 =

我只有这个代码,但这不是个好主意

在安卓系统中,如何使用手指制作左键点击监听器

@Override
public boolean onTouchEvent(MotionEvent event) {
    // TODO Auto-generated method stub
    super.onTouchEvent(event);

    int action = event.getAction() & MotionEvent.ACTION_MASK;
    float x1 = 0, x2 = 0;

    switch (action) {
        case MotionEvent.ACTION_DOWN: {
              x1 = event.getX();
            break;
        }
        case MotionEvent.ACTION_UP: {
              x2 = event.getX();
            break;
        }
    }

如果我理解正确,您想用左手/手指识别点击


如果正确,那么我知道没有办法做到这一点…

您的代码有什么问题?您的问题到底是什么?